    I can't stand when a game is released with glaringly obvious flaws in balance, and the developers proceed to do absolutely nothing about it. The two biggest examples off the top of my head that I'm currently playing are Star Wars: The Old Republic, and Call of Duty: Modern Warfare 3.

    Without getting into too much detail, classes in SWTOR are arranged so that each faction has an equivalent mirror class in the opposite faction. For example, the Jedi Knight vs. the Sith Warrior. Both are medium/heavy armor melee DPS or tanking classes, able to equip one or two single-blade lightsabers, and their abilities are all basically equivalent. Same goes for Republic Trooper vs. Bounty Hunter, Smuggler vs. Imperial Agent. However, Bioware really dropped the ball between the Jedi Consular and the Sith Inquisitor. Long story short, each class has an "instant" long-range Force damage ability. The Sith version is called Shock, and simply instantly electrocutes a target upon casting. The Consular mirror ability, Project, has an instant cast, but involves a 1-second animation in which the Jedi pulls a rock or junk out of the ground and throws it at the target. In the Jedi's case, the damage is delayed by that one second, while the Inquisitor's mirror ability is fully instant.

    This may not seem like a huge deal in the grand scheme of things, but look at this way: there is no way to avoid the Sith's Shock ability. You can't see it coming, you can't interrupt it, and damage is instant. In PvP, I can't tell you how many times I've cast Project at someone only to have them activate Vanish and stealth away, leaving my rock floating and dealing no damage. Also, if the enemy is capping a point or something, Shock will instantly interrupt that action as soon as the button is clicked, while Project will not interrupt until the rock floats up, flies and hits its target.

    This has been a known issue and has been posted about in the SWTOR forums in multiple hundred-page long threads in the months since the game's release, and there have been two major content patches and countless weekly patches, with no fix for this.

    My other example, Call of Duty. It seems like the developers release the game, fix one thing in the first patch that they do, and then never touch the game ever again. In Modern Warfare 2, it's what happened with the Model 1887 shotgun and Care Package sprinting; they fixed those in the only patch that game ever received, and the game was never updated again, leaving huge balance issues like the akimbo G18's untouched. The same is happening now in MW3; things like akimbo FMG9's and the MP7 are blatantly overpowered and throw off the balance of the game to the point that if you don't use the MP7, you are statistically crippling yourself because it is better than every other weapon. And I know it will never get fixed.

    Plenty of games have had balance issues through the years, but at least most developers have the decency to try and do something about it. Team Fortress 2 introduces new weapons and items with new stats all the time, and yet Valve finds the time to go back and balance things, often multiple times. Battlefield 3 has gone through several balance tweak patches. Not all of them have been very popular, but god damn, at least DICE is trying.
